Smylie Brothers Brewing Company Celebrates 1-Year Anniversary
Smylie Brothers Brewing Company Celebrates One Year Anniversary with a Pig Roast, Live Music, and Special Beer Tappings
With their first year of operations under their belts, Smylie Brothers Brewing Company (1615 Oak Avenue) will host a celebration for friends and customers on Saturday, June 27.
“Hard to believe it has been a year already! The build-out and lead up to open required an incredible effort by everyone on our team. Without them and the fantastic turnout from the community to support us, we would not be where we are today,” says owner Mike Smylie.
It was just a year ago that Smylie Brothers opened the doors to the Evanston brewpub housed in the former social security office (and prior to that, the beloved Oak Street Market). In the first year, owner Mike Smylie estimates that the brewpub has served over 6,500 pounds of brisket, over 16,000 pizzas, and over 600 barrels of beer (with the IPA and Farmhouse being the most popular).

Those joining Smylie Brothers Brewing Co. on June 27 can enjoy any of the Smylie Brothers’ core beers for just $5 a pint and the brewing team will be on hand to discuss beer, give brewery tours, and tap special firkins throughout the day. On the food side, starting at 5:00, diners will enjoy a pig roast complete with family style BBQ. Live music from local Grateful Dead cover band, Jackstraw, completes the party. Tickets to Smylie Brothers’ first-anniversary party are $30 each ($15 for kids 12 and under) and are available by calling the brewpub at 224-999-7323 or through the Smylie Brothers website (www.smyliebrothers.com).
